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5390345 601884072 7165255 13776
0774790 2979290294 7664194515
0774790 2979290294 7664194515
14 878 989830995
All about undefined
Interested in learning more?
0774790 2979290294 7664194515
14 878 989830995
See more
4873213722 80589
923737594 0986 5335
See more
5344569411 911 926846674
859 621144 73667
See more